About The Position

This position will offer you the ability to directly apply your knowledge of transmission line engineering including, conductors, hardware, insulation, structures, foundations and electrical principles to design transmission lines in the 69kV to 765kV range. You will perform structural analysis and design of pole, lattice, framed, and guyed structures, as well as foundation designs. Responsibilities include conductor selection studies, shielding, grounding and induction studies. You will also develop cost estimates and schedules and prepare specifications for the procurement of transmission line materials and construction, and specify transmission line components. Additionally, you will model transmission lines in PLS-CADD, determine right of way requirements, calculate conductor sags, and develop transmission line plan and profile drawings.
